PHIL 380 - Aesthetics

Credits: (3)
Instructional Method: Three hours lecture.
Prerequisites: Three hours of philosophy.
Explores various theories and philosophical issues concerning the nature of creativity and the nature and significance of art in all of its forms. Students engage in a critical examination of such questions as these: what exactly do we mean by a “work of art?” What is beauty? What is an aesthetic experience? How are aesthetic values related to other sorts of values? What sort of truth can be found in art?
